C12 Quantum Electronics has a total of 25 patents globally, out of which 2 have been granted. Of these 25 patents, 80% patents are active. France seems to be the main focused R&D centre and also is the origin country of C12 Quantum Electronics.
C12 Quantum Electronics was founded in 2020. A company that designs and builds quantum processors and computers to make complex computing faster, while helping industrial clients use early-stage quantum applications in their operations.

How many patents does C12 Quantum Electronics have?
C12 Quantum Electronics has a total of 25 patents globally. These patents belong to 5 unique patent families. Out of 25 patents, 20 patents are active.
How Many Patents did C12 Quantum Electronics File Every Year?

Are you wondering why there is a drop in patent filing for the last two years? It is because a patent application can take up to 18 months to get published. Certainly, it doesn’t suggest a decrease in the patent filing.
| Year of Patents Filing or Grant | C12 Quantum Electronics Applications Filed | C12 Quantum Electronics Patents Granted |
| 2025 | – | 2 |
| 2024 | 1 | – |
| 2023 | 15 | – |
| 2022 | 9 | – |

How Many Patents did C12 Quantum Electronics File in Different Countries?

Countries in which C12 Quantum Electronics Filed Patents
| Country | Patents |
| France | 4 |
| Japan | 4 |
| Europe (EPO) | 4 |
| China | 4 |
| United States of America | 3 |
Where are Research Centers of C12 Quantum Electronics Patents Located?
The Research Centers of C12 Quantum Electronics Patents is France.
What Percentage of C12 Quantum Electronics US Patent Applications were Granted?
C12 Quantum Electronics (Excluding its subsidiaries) has filed 2 patent applications at USPTO so far (Excluding Design and PCT applications). Out of these 1 have been granted leading to a grant rate of 100%.
